在当今技术不断发展的时代,开源项目与社群越来越受到关注。特别是GitHub这一平台,吸引了无数开发者和爱好者。其中,橘猫作为一种可爱且广受欢迎的猫咪品种,其相关的GitHub项目也在悄然兴起。本文将深入探讨“橘猫的GitHub”,包括其相关项目、代码和使用情况。
1. 橘猫的魅力
橘猫以其可爱的外貌和温和的性格受到许多人的喜爱。以下是橘猫的一些特色:
- 颜色:橘猫通常呈现出鲜艳的橘色,配有独特的斑纹。
- 性格:性格温和、友善,适合家庭养殖。
- 智能:橘猫通常比较聪明,容易训练。
2. GitHub上的橘猫项目
GitHub上有很多与橘猫相关的项目,这些项目通常是由爱好者创建,涉及多个领域:
- 图像处理:使用橘猫的图片进行图像处理和分析。
- 游戏开发:创建以橘猫为主题的小游戏。
- 社交媒体应用:开发与橘猫相关的社交媒体分享工具。
2.1 图像处理项目
在GitHub上,有一些项目专注于使用橘猫的图像进行机器学习和计算机视觉研究。
- 橘猫识别:创建一个模型,能识别出橘猫的图片,采用深度学习方法。
- 图片风格转换:使用橘猫的图像进行风格转换,生成艺术效果图。
2.2 游戏开发项目
许多开发者利用橘猫作为主题,创建有趣的小游戏,这些项目通常包含:
- 橘猫冒险游戏:设计一款橘猫为主角的横版冒险游戏。
- 橘猫养成游戏:开发一款让玩家养成橘猫的模拟游戏。
2.3 社交媒体应用项目
一些开发者也创造了与橘猫相关的社交媒体应用,这些项目的主要功能包括:
- 图片分享:允许用户分享自己橘猫的照片。
- 橘猫社群:建立橘猫爱好者的在线社区。
3. 橘猫项目的代码分析
在分析橘猫相关的GitHub代码时,我们发现了一些共同点:
- 易于理解:大多数项目的代码结构清晰,注释详细,便于初学者学习。
- 模块化设计:许多项目采用模块化设计,使得功能扩展变得简单。
3.1 图像处理代码示例
在图像处理项目中,我们可以看到使用Python及其相关库的示例代码:
python import cv2
image = cv2.imread(‘orange_cat.jpg’)
processed_image =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
3.2 游戏开发代码示例
游戏开发中常用的语言为JavaScript和Unity,以下是一个简单的游戏代码片段:
javascript class OrangeCat { constructor(name) { this.name = name; } meow() { console.log(this.name + ‘ says meow!’); }}
4. 如何参与橘猫的GitHub项目
如果你对橘猫的GitHub项目感兴趣,以下是一些参与的方式:
- Fork项目:将你感兴趣的项目Fork到你的账号。
- 提交问题:在项目的Issues中提交问题或建议。
- 贡献代码:修复bug或添加新功能,向项目提交Pull Request。
5. FAQ:关于橘猫的GitHub
Q1: 橘猫的GitHub项目主要是什么类型的?
A1: 橘猫的GitHub项目主要涵盖图像处理、游戏开发以及社交媒体应用等多个类型。
Q2: 我如何找到橘猫相关的GitHub项目?
A2: 你可以通过GitHub搜索栏输入“橘猫”或“orange cat”,以查找相关项目。
Q3: 橘猫项目是否适合初学者?
A3: 是的,许多橘猫相关项目的代码结构清晰,适合初学者学习和参与。
Q4: 我能否在自己的项目中使用橘猫的图片?
A4: 使用橘猫图片时请遵循版权规定,确保拥有使用权或选择使用开源的图片资源。
Q5: 橘猫的GitHub项目有哪些值得推荐的?
A5: 推荐关注一些图像识别和游戏开发相关的项目,它们通常比较有趣且具备实用价值。
结语
橘猫在GitHub上的项目为开发者提供了一个富有创意的舞台,展示了可爱与技术的结合。希望通过本文,能引起更多人的关注与参与,让我们一同在这个充满活力的开源社区中,探索橘猫的无限可能。